Image 191 of 3904th February 1788


Saint Clement Danes

Middlesex

to wit James Talboys< no role > One of the Beadles
of the Parish of Saint Clement Danes maketh
Oath and Saith that he has been credibly
Informed which Information he believes to be
true that Rebecca Cox< no role > the Mother of Richd.
Cox
< no role > an Infant aged about 4 years born a
Bastard in a Licensed Hospital lived as a
hired yearly Servant when Single at the
Dyers Arms in Cole Harbour in the Parish
of Allhallows the Less in the City of London
for 12 Months and upwards at the
yearly wages of £4 or £5 that after she
quitted said Service she has done no act
to gain any other Settlement


Sworn this 4th.
day of Febry. 1788
Sampr Wright< no role > Wm. Hitchiner< no role >

James Talboys< no role >
